Down's
left corner back Emmett Dorrian has been forced
to withdraw from the team to face New York in
Sunday's Guinness Ulster SHC semi-final at Gaelic
Park after picking up a late injury.
Dorrian pulled a hamstring in training at Randal's
Island on Friday and will not now be part of the
starting line-up. Manager John Crossey has not
yet decided on a replacement and is not likely
to reveal him until just before throw-in.
Michael Braniff, Ryan Conlon or James Henry Hughes
are all possible candidates, and some positional
re-jigging may be done to facilitate the change.
Meanwhile, Paul Braniff arrived in New York on
Friday to join his team mates. Braniff's arrival
was delayed as the UUJ engineering student was
sitting exams until Thursday.
Down (SH v New York): G Clarke; L Clarke, S Murray,
AN Other, S Wilson, G Savage, G Clarke; A Savage,
G Adair; G McGrattan, P Braniff, B McGourty; M
Coulter, G Johnson, J Convery.
